Mindpik Creates Legendary Sales MeetingsThink about it... what do you want to accomplish in a sales meeting? Communicate product information? Train the sales force in the advantages and uh-oh's of your products? Show them where to find customers?

What about the excitement? The incredible rush for the sales people in knowing they're with a winner? And don't forget the relationship building -- the tearing down of fences and built-up animosities.

A good sales meeting should accomplish all of those things

Mindpik routinely creates and drives sales meetings for its clients. To us that includes finding a site, creating a theme, driving the company literature to be sure everything is in place, creating presentation formats and even writing and giving presentations if it comes to that. We believe the company sales meeting, whether a routine regional/area meeting or the annual blowout, can be the event that brings the company together and launches new products into the marketplace. Of all the events that happen over the course of the year, this is one the company is totally responsible for and it's essential to make it memorable
